Decide What Handmade Products to Sell

 

The first step in making money with handmade products online is determining what you will create and sell. While this may seem obvious, it’s important to understand that certain products are more profitable than others, and it’s crucial to identify a niche that aligns with both your skills and the market demand.

Popular Handmade Product Categories:

  • Jewelry: Handmade jewelry, from necklaces and bracelets to earrings and rings, is one of the most sought-after product categories. Customized and personalized jewelry, such as engraved pieces or birthstone designs, is especially popular.

  • Home Décor: People love unique home décor items, such as hand-painted art, decorative pillows, wooden furniture, and upcycled pieces. Customized home décor, including personalized family name signs or wedding décor, can also attract a premium price.

  • Clothing and Accessories: Handmade clothing like knit scarves, custom-designed shirts, or hand-sewn dresses can be a profitable niche. Accessories such as handbags, hats, and belts can also generate consistent sales.

  • Beauty and Skincare Products: Many crafters create handmade skincare items such as soaps, lotions, scrubs, and candles. Organic and eco-friendly products are increasingly in demand.

  • Stationery and Paper Goods: Handmade journals, greeting cards, planners, and other stationery products can cater to customers who appreciate the personal touch in their office supplies or gifts.

  • Toys and Baby Products: Handcrafted toys, baby clothes, blankets, and nursery décor are popular for parents who want something special and unique for their children.

Identify Your Passion and Skills:

Consider your interests and strengths when selecting a product to sell. If you love creating jewelry, that might be the perfect niche for you. If you’re passionate about sustainability, you might want to make eco-friendly products, such as natural soaps or reusable bags. Combining your passion with your skills will not only make your work more enjoyable but will also make it easier to market your products.


Set Up Your Handmade Business

 

Once you’ve decided on the products you want to sell, the next step is setting up your business. Creating a solid foundation for your handmade business is key to long-term success.

Legal Considerations:

  • Business Structure: You’ll need to decide what type of business structure you want to set up. Many handmade business owners choose to operate as sole proprietors, but forming an LLC (Limited Liability Company) may provide additional legal protection, especially as your business grows.

  • Business Name: Choose a memorable, catchy business name that reflects your brand and resonates with your target audience. Make sure the name is unique, available, and easy to remember.

  • Licensing and Permits: Depending on where you live, you may need to obtain a business license, sales tax permit, or other permits to legally sell handmade goods. Be sure to check with your local authorities or a legal advisor to ensure compliance with regulations.

  • Taxes: Keep accurate records of all your business expenses and income. You may need to file self-employment taxes, and keeping track of your finances will ensure you’re prepared for tax season.

Branding Your Handmade Business:

  • Create a Logo: Your logo is an essential part of your brand identity. Consider using online design tools like Canva or hiring a freelance designer to create a professional logo for your business.

  • Develop Your Brand Voice: Decide on your brand’s personality and tone. Are you fun and quirky? Elegant and luxurious? Eco-conscious and sustainable? The way you present yourself will help you connect with your target audience.

  • Packaging: Packaging plays a significant role in delivering a memorable experience to your customers. Invest in custom packaging, such as branded boxes or tissue paper, to add a special touch to each order.


Set Up an Online Store

 

With your business established and your products ready to sell, it’s time to choose an online platform to list and sell your handmade items. There are several great options, each with its pros and cons, so choose the one that best suits your business goals.

Best Platforms for Selling Handmade Products:

  • Etsy: Etsy is the go-to platform for handmade products, with millions of buyers searching for unique items. Setting up an Etsy store is easy, and the platform provides a vast audience, making it an excellent choice for those starting out. Etsy charges listing fees and takes a small commission on sales, but it provides great exposure for handmade creators.

  • Shopify: If you want more control over your store and branding, consider using Shopify. With Shopify, you can create a fully customizable online store and sell your products directly. This platform is great if you want to scale your business, but it does require a monthly subscription fee and additional setup.

  • Big Cartel: Big Cartel is an affordable option for those just starting out. It offers simple, easy-to-use features and allows you to sell handmade products without the high fees of other platforms. It’s perfect for smaller shops with fewer products.

  • Amazon Handmade: Amazon Handmade is another marketplace for selling handmade products, especially if you already have a presence on Amazon. It allows you to tap into Amazon’s massive customer base, though there are membership fees and strict application processes.

  • Your Own Website: If you prefer complete control over your sales process and branding, setting up your own website is a great choice. You can use website builders like WordPress or Wix to set up an e-commerce store with ease. You’ll need to handle your own marketing, but this option allows you to build a long-term business with more customization.

Product Listings:

When creating product listings, ensure that they are detailed and compelling. Use high-quality images, clear descriptions, and highlight the unique qualities of your products. Include the size, color, material, and any other important information. The more thorough your listings, the more likely potential customers will feel confident in making a purchase.

Payment Methods:

Most platforms, including Etsy and Shopify, integrate payment gateways like PayPal, Stripe, or direct credit card payments. Make sure to offer convenient, secure payment methods for your customers to ensure smooth transactions.

Price Your Handmade Products

 

Pricing your handmade products can be tricky, but it’s important to find a balance between covering your costs and generating a profit while remaining competitive. Consider the following factors when pricing:

Cost of Materials:

Calculate the cost of raw materials and ingredients used to create your product. This should be the baseline for your pricing.

Time Spent Creating:

Factor in the time it takes you to create each item. As a rule of thumb, many artisans charge at least $15 per hour for their time, but this may vary depending on your skill level and the market demand.

Overhead Costs:

Don’t forget to include the costs of running your business, such as packaging, website hosting fees, marketing, and shipping.

Market Research:

Look at what other sellers in your niche are charging. This will give you a sense of the competitive price range, helping you to price your products appropriately.

Profit Margin:

Aim for a reasonable profit margin, typically 30-50% above your cost of goods sold (COGS). This allows you to cover business expenses and reinvest in your business.


Marketing and Promoting Your Handmade Products

 

Marketing is crucial to generating traffic and sales for your handmade products. Without an effective marketing strategy, even the best products can go unnoticed.

Social Media Marketing:

Social media platforms such as Instagram, Facebook, Pinterest, and TikTok are essential tools for promoting your handmade products. They are visual platforms that work well for showcasing your products in creative ways. Here’s how you can use social media to your advantage:

  • Instagram: Post high-quality images of your products, behind-the-scenes content, customer testimonials, and lifestyle shots. Use relevant hashtags to increase visibility and engage with your audience by responding to comments and messages.

  • Facebook: Create a business page, join relevant groups, and run Facebook ads to target your ideal customers. Facebook also has a marketplace where you can list your products.

  • Pinterest: Pinterest is a search engine for visual content. Pinning your products to boards, especially lifestyle or gift-related boards, can drive significant traffic to your online store.

  • TikTok: Share short videos showing your products in use, behind-the-scenes creation process, or even tutorials. TikTok has a highly engaged audience, and creative videos can go viral.

Email Marketing:

Building an email list is an excellent way to stay connected with potential and existing customers. Offer a discount or freebie in exchange for their email address and send regular newsletters with updates, promotions, and new product launches. Tools like MailChimp or ConvertKit can help you manage your email campaigns.

Collaborations and Influencer Marketing:

Collaborate with influencers or bloggers in your niche to showcase your products. They can provide social proof and introduce your brand to a wider audience.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O):

Optimize your product listings and website for search engines by using relevant keywords in your titles, descriptions, and tags. SEO will help your handmade products rank higher in search results, making it easier for potential customers to find you.


Provide Excellent Customer Service

 

Providing top-notch customer service is key to building long-term relationships with your customers and encouraging repeat business.

Communication:

Respond promptly to customer inquiries and address any issues or concerns professionally. Clear and polite communication builds trust.

Fast Shipping:

Offer fast and reliable shipping options. Customers appreciate timely delivery, and offering a tracking number provides them with peace of mind.

Quality Control:

Ensure that all products are made with high-quality materials and craftsmanship. A well-made product leads to satisfied customers and positive reviews.

Personalization:

Personalized thank-you notes or small freebies in each order can make your customers feel appreciated and valued.
